Where to Manage Them
You can control which notifications Bits sends—for example, a daily nudge to write—from the More tab. Turn on what helps you stay consistent; turn off what you don’t want.
- Open the More tab.
- Tap Notifications (or the notifications row). You’ll see the list of notification types Bits offers and toggles for each.
Common Notifications
- Daily reminder – A reminder to write something today, often tied to Comedy Gym. Useful if you’re building a daily writing habit. When you turn it on, you may be asked to allow notifications for Bits in your device settings if you haven’t already.
- Other types – The app may offer additional notifications (e.g. for backup or account). Each will have a short description; turn on only the ones you want.
If Notifications Don’t Appear
- Check iPhone Settings > Notifications > Bits. Make sure “Allow Notifications” is on and that the alert style (banner, lock screen, etc.) is what you want.
- In Bits, make sure the specific notification (e.g. daily reminder) is turned on in More > Notifications.
Once both the app and system settings allow notifications, you should receive them according to the schedule Bits uses (e.g. once per day for the daily reminder).
